Arrowhead Research Corp. (NASDAQ:ARWR) on Aug. 12 announced financial results for its fiscal 2014 third quarter ended June 30, 2014 and provided an update on the Phase 2a study of ARC-520, its RNAi-based candidate for the treatment of chronic hepatitis B infection. Net loss attributable to Arrowhead for the quarter was $11.6 million, or $0.22 per share based on 51.9 million weighted average shares outstanding. This compares with a net loss attributable to Arrowhead of $6.1 million, or $0.23 per share based on 26.1 million weighted average shares outstanding, for the quarter ended June 30, 2013. On 31 July 2014, RGC Resources, Inc. (NASDAQ:RGCO) announced consolidated Company earnings of $283,194 or $0.06 per average share outstanding for the quarter ended June 30, 2014. This compares to consolidated earnings of $110,103 or $0.02 per average share outstanding for the quarter ended June 30, 2013. CFO Paul Nester attributed the increase in earnings to improved utility margins from higher sales volumes. Earnings for the twelve months ending June 30, 2014 were $4,751,866 or $1.01 per share compared to $0.91 per share for the twelve months ended June 30, 2013. Nester attributed the higher year-over-year earnings primarily to improved utility margins from higher sales volumes. On 02 September, RGC Resources, Inc. American Electric Power Co., Inc. (NYSE:AEP) says explosions that sent manhole covers flying in downtown Columbus last February happened when insulation material on electricity cables broke down because of water, salt and other factors. Nobody was injured in the explosions that sent two manhole covers into the air and shattered one. The Columbus Dispatch reports the utility is spending around $30 million to prevent any similar explosions. AEP says the cracked insulation exposed metal wires to the air and the high level of electricity running through the cables produced heat. American Electric Power Co., Inc. American Science & Engineering (NASDAQ:ASEI)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, July 31st. The company reported $0.18 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.32 by $0.14. The company had revenue of $35.54 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$39.90 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company posted $0.62 earnings per share. The company’s revenue for the quarter was down 17.5% on a year-over-year basis. Analysts expect that American Science & Engineering will post $1.70 earnings per share for the current fiscal year. American Science & Engineering Inc.
